Potassium is a critical electrolyte for athletes and active individuals. It helps regulate fluid balance, nerve signaling, and muscle contractions — all of which are put to the test during exercise. When you sweat, you lose potassium, and if you don't replace it, you may experience muscle cramps, weakness, or fatigue. How It Works
The calculator combines two components: a baseline requirement and an exercise adjustment. The baseline is derived from general recommendations that active individuals need more potassium than sedentary ones. We use a per-kilogram factor that increases with activity intensity. The exercise adjustment estimates potassium lost in sweat. Sweat contains roughly 150–250 mg of potassium per liter, so we use 200 mg/L as a reasonable average. Your sweat loss in liters is calculated by multiplying your sweat rate by the exercise duration in hours. This loss is added to your baseline to give a total daily target.
Formula: Total Potassium (mg) = (Body Weight in kg × Activity Factor) + (Sweat Rate in L/h × Exercise Hours × 200 mg/L)
Worked Examples
Example 1: A 70 kg runner, active level (factor 55), runs 1 hour with a sweat rate of 1.2 L/h. Base need = 70 × 55 = 3850 mg. Sweat loss = 1.2 × 1 × 200 = 240 mg. Total = 4090 mg.
Example 2: A 60 kg cyclist, moderate level (factor 50), rides 2 hours with a sweat rate of 0.8 L/h. Base need = 60 × 50 = 3000 mg. Sweat loss = 0.8 × 2 × 200 = 320 mg. Total = 3320 mg.
Tips & Best Practices
- Weigh yourself before and after exercise to estimate your sweat rate: 1 kg lost ≈ 1 liter of sweat.
- Include potassium-rich foods in your meals: bananas, oranges, potatoes, spinach, yogurt, and beans.
- For sessions longer than 2 hours, consider electrolyte drinks or supplements, but consult a professional first.
- Don't exceed the upper limit of 4700 mg for most adults unless advised by a doctor, as excessive potassium can be harmful.
Factors Affecting Accuracy
Individual sweat composition varies widely. Some people lose more potassium per liter of sweat, especially if they are salty sweaters. Heat and humidity increase sweat rate, so adjust your input accordingly. Also, your baseline need may be higher if you are in heavy training or live in a hot climate. This calculator provides an estimate, not a medical prescription. Always listen to your body and consult a sports nutritionist for personalized advice.
Frequently Asked Questions
What is the recommended daily potassium intake for athletes?
The general recommendation for adults is 4700 mg per day, but athletes may need more due to sweat losses. This calculator helps you estimate that extra amount.
Can I get enough potassium from food alone?
Yes, most people can meet their needs with a diet rich in fruits, vegetables, and legumes. For example, a medium banana has about 422 mg, a baked potato has about 926 mg, and a cup of cooked spinach has about 839 mg.
What are the symptoms of low potassium?
Muscle cramps, weakness, fatigue, and irregular heartbeat can be signs of hypokalemia. If you experience these, especially during exercise, seek medical advice.
Should I take potassium supplements?
Only under medical supervision. Too much potassium can be dangerous, especially for people with kidney issues. Food sources are generally safer and more effective.
